Despite the rising appeal of online casinos the lawful framework surrounding gambling on the internet in Philippines is not simple. It is the Philippine Amusement and Gaming Corporation oversees the online and land-based gambling industry in order to ensure that licensed operators adhere to strict regulations. PAGCOR additionally oversees the Philippine Offshore Gaming Operators that are internet-based casino companies licensed to cater to foreign markets. Although these companies contribute significantly for their contribution to the Philippine economy, they've also sparked controversy due to issues with their effect on local infrastructure, crimes and the social fabric. Online gambling in the Philippines is strictly monitored, and Filipino citizens are not allowed to accessing local websites, however, many of them access sites operating outside the PAGCOR's jurisdiction. Another issue with online casinos within the Philippines is the threat of gambling addiction. It is easy to access and the anonymity offered by online gambling could make it hard for people to recognize when their gambling habits are becoming risky. Without the social and financial limitations that physical casinos offer certain players could spend an excessive amount of time and money betting on the internet than they are able to manage to. That has led to demand for more comprehensive safe gambling practices within the industry, such as deposit limitations, self-exclusion choices, and more public awareness initiatives. PAGCOR and licensed operators are increasingly implementing these tools to help players manage their gambling behavior However, more work needs to be put into place to reduce the risks of the growing online gambling market.
